McDonough County Information
McDonough in
Illinois occupies
590 square miles and has a 2006 population of
31,823, a change from a 2000 population of
32,918 and
35,244 in 1990.
33.9% percent of the population is between the ages of 15 and 24,
12.1% percent is 25-35, and
8.8% percent of the population is 35 to 44.
